Director of Worship
SUMMARY
In support of the university’s mission and objectives, the Director of Worship provides strategic leadership, creative direction, and oversight for all worship experiences on campus. This role is responsible for envisioning, planning, executing worship services that are spiritually enriching, engaging, and culturally relevant. This leader develops and disciples student worship teams, manages the worship schedule, and collaborates with internal and external stakeholders to create a vibrant and impactful worship experience.

Worship Strategy and Creative Leadership:
  • Provides visionary leadership in developing the academic year and summer worship schedule/calendar.
  • Recruits, develops, and mentors student worship leaders for involvement in Chapel, Anchor, and other campus events.
  • Curates worship sets and carefully considers how it integrates with the event, message, worship team ability, and style-of-worship preferences of the student body.
  • Trains, leads, and manages the student worship teams, chapel volunteers, and others who assist with chapel and worship opportunities on and off campus. Helping them to grow as worship leaders, musicians, and artists.
  • Oversees the creative design of chapel services, including production, lighting, and multimedia elements, ensuring a seamless and meaningful experience.
  • Programs worship elements for other departmental such as admission recruitment days, welcome weeks, and special services.
  • Manages multiple event deadlines, providing organizational oversight to worship team participation across various events throughout the week.
